Our latest room re-do at the beautiful Maleny Manor has just been completed and I would love to share some photos with you. Marlene asked for something classical with a French Country look but with a little pop of colour. Together we chose a classical damask style fabric in Taupe with a co-ordinating plain from Charles Parsons as our starting point. This was used for the coverlet, curtains, pelmet and cushions. To add some glamour and zing I chose a luscious velvet from Wilson Fabrics, Avida in Cornsilk, for the bed head and bed valance as well as more cushions and then the pop of colour was brought in with Ken Bimler’s Tudor Rose ‘Taupe’. For light filtering and privacy sheer curtains in Nettex Pulse ‘Champagne’ are also used. Here are the results I hope you love it as much as we do.
We have just received a new hanger from the Slender Morris library that I am very excited about. It is a gorgeous print collection named The Abbey Road Collection. There are four colour ranges and each colour has three designs. Portobello V is a lovely floral print in 100% linen, Sussex Stripe is a classic variegated stripe with a composition of 52% linen and 48% cotton and the Bray Flamestitch is also 100% linen. The range would be perfect for a combination of drapes, roman blinds, cushions and light upholstery. The colours are fresh, fun and contemporary whilst still being classical and timeless.
